Bug description:
Mudlet: 1.0.3
System: Mac OS X 10.5.8

With the recent updates (1.0.3, possibly 1.0.2 as well), the "Fix new text to be on its own line" option in the settings seems to be behaving oddly. I used it prior to the updates without issue, and I think it's related to the fix on command echoes.

With command echoing on, a new line is created for each command, as the following picture shows.

Without command echoing on, the blank lines seem to be created for the echoed commands despite the fact that echoing is off. See here:

This is pretty troublesome, especially when you want to minimize vertical scroll, or don't want big gaps to appear all over the place when text is redirected to miniconsoles (text seems to be running past the borders layed out for each miniconsole as well, but that's another deal).
